What is business resilience?

A Business Resilience job focuses on identifying, assessing, and mitigating risks that could disrupt an organization's operations. Professionals in this role develop strategies and frameworks to enhance a company's ability to respond to crises, such as cyberattacks, natural disasters, or supply chain disruptions. They work closely with leadership, IT, and operations teams to ensure business continuity and recovery plans are in place. The goal is to minimize downtime, protect assets, and maintain stability in the face of unforeseen challenges.

What does someone in business resilience do?

Professionals in Business Resilience spend their days assessing organizational risks, developing and refining business continuity and disaster recovery plans, and coordinating training or simulation exercises to prepare teams for potential disruptions. They collaborate closely with stakeholders across departments such as IT, operations, and executive leadership to ensure resilience strategies are integrated throughout the organization. Regularly, they monitor incident reports, evaluate compliance with industry standards, and provide guidance during real-time crisis events. This mix of planning, cross-team collaboration, and hands-on response ensures the company remains prepared and adaptable in the face of unexpected challenges.

What skills and qualifications are needed for business resilience?

To thrive in Business Resilience, you need a strong background in risk management, business continuity planning, and crisis response, often supported by a bachelor's degree in business, risk management, or a related field. Familiarity with business continuity management tools (such as Fusion Risk Management or Archer), ISO 22301 certification, and incident management platforms is highly valued. Outstanding organizational abilities, analytical thinking, and strong communication skills help individuals lead cross-functional teams and drive improvements. These skills are crucial to ensure organizations can effectively prepare for, respond to, and recover from disruptive incidents.

The Business Resilience Manager reports to the Chief Risk Officer. The Business Resilience Manager is responsible for overseeing all aspects of the company's Business Resiliency program including Crisis Management, Cyber Response, Business Continuity (and supporting vendors), as well as tracking and reporting on Disaster Recovery activities. The focus of this position will be to build business resiliency to current and future threats to protect the viability and sustainability of operations. The position supports all activities necessary to enable effective responses to both planned and unplanned business interruptions. This position supports all activities for the development, testing, maintenance of all Business Resilience plans, and documentation, and ensures key stakeholders have appropriate training and support to execute their plans.
